First things first, let's talk about what a geode is. A geode is a rock that contains a hollow cavity lined with crystals. These beautiful formations can be found in various shapes, sizes, and colors. Now, let's get to the fun part - identifying the crystals inside!

Step 1: Observe the Exterior

Take a good look at the outside of your geode. Notice its shape, texture, and any unique features. Geodes come in different forms, such as spherical, egg-shaped, or even elongated. Step 2: Crack It Open

To reveal the crystals within your geode, you'll need to crack it open. This can be done using a geode cracker, a hammer, or even a chisel. Place the geode in a sock or wrap it in a towel to protect it from shattering. Gently tap the geode along its natural seams until it cracks open. Be patient and cautious during this process to avoid damaging the crystals inside.

Step 3: Examine the Crystals

Once your geode is cracked open, take a close look at the crystals inside. Pay attention to their color, shape, and size. Some common crystals you might find include amethyst, quartz, calcite, agate, or even celestite.
